Prince Georges announces tribute to women

By Staff

Feb. 22, 2010, 12 a.m. - Prince George’s County Executive Jack Johnson announced that this year’s theme: “Prince George’s Women Continuing A Legacy of Leadership and Service” will differ from the National theme, in order to celebrate the county’s special recognition luncheon that has been consistently hosted for the past 25 years to honor outstanding county government women.

 

“From past to present, women continue to make significant contributions in the operational, administrative and public safety sectors of our county government,” said Johnson. “I am proud that our county has been hosting this important luncheon to honor and celebrate women in government.”

 

During the luncheon, the highly anticipated Gladys Noon Spellman Award and scholarships will be presented.  Throughout her career as a public servant, Gladys Noon Spellman successfully spearheaded many efforts to effect social and political reform in all facets of life for her native Prince George's County, for the State of Maryland, and for the nation.
